Is it Allowed to Sit In front of a Person Who Missed Some of the Prayer In order to be a Sutrah for Him? – Shaikh al-Albani

Questioner: If a person comes and sits in front of a praying person so that he can be a sutrah for him, is this considered passing in front of the praying person?

Shaikh: Is what?

Questioner: Is it considered passing in front of the congregants, that is, is this action allowed?

Shaikh: Between him and the person praying and between sitting?

Questioner: He does not have a sutrah in front of him and the prayer ended. So a person comes so that he can be a sutrah for this man

Shaikh: This is the one who sits?

Questioner: Yes

Shaikh: So that he can be a sutrah for him. This is not considered passing in front of him

Questioner: Yes

Shaikh: This is a good affair from the angle of cooperating upon good“.

[Silsilatul Huda wan-Nur no. 776]
